Output 620dbf58d30e790495374df8a53e2474280e4a234c53fca41291c6753268a391:0

value
9214745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c66168d654b56158a7dbfd06366a865efab5851 OP_EQUAL
address
38eyaKyrBPzLYpFwwBcKKAncWrE7jbpe42
transaction
620dbf58d30e790495374df8a53e2474280e4a234c53fca41291c6753268a391
spent
true